Перейти к содержимому

Реферальная программа Мегаплана

Партнерская программа Expressrxsales

Как сделать меню без перезагрузки контента?

#1 hnerd

hnerd
  • Пользователь
  • 284 сообщений
  • Репутация: 18
0

Отправлено 20 Ноябрь 2014 - 02:48

Здравствуйте! Хочу реализовать такое меню, при нажатии на пункты которого меняется контент без перезагрузки страницы. Я знаю один способ это реализовать: с помощью javascript и display:none и display:block

 

Но недавно на одном из движков увидела, что они это как то реализуют по-другому. Вроде бы как анкоры создают с "#". Может это более профессионально? Тоже бы хотела научиться этому.

 

Не подскажете какие-нибудь статьи на эту тему и плагины на jquery.

 

Если что. у меня самописный движок.

 

За примерами далеко бежать не нужно На этом сайте http://sosnovskij.ru/  в правом сайтбаре такое меню как раз есть с зелеными кнопочками. Только здесь это вроду бы реализовано обычно.


 

 

Сообщение отредактировал hnerd: 20 Ноябрь 2014 - 02:55

  • 0

robot

robot
  • Пользователь PRO
  • 2 652 сообщений
  • Репутация: 85
Советую обратить внимание на следующее:
  1. Меню
  2. Изменение контента страницы...
  3. Как подгружать содержимое на страницу без перезагрузки
  4. Вставка информации в контент в зависимости от страницы
  5. Usability вашего интернет-магазина (статья)

#2 DeHuC_64

DeHuC_64
  • Пользователь
  • 459 сообщений
  • Репутация: 41

Отправлено 20 Ноябрь 2014 - 03:10

hnerd, это вкладки, а если быть точнее табы, посмотрите в сети много информации о них, да и примеров куча, они реализуются не сложно....


  • 0

#3 temp-market

temp-market
  • Пользователь
  • 45 сообщений
  • Репутация: -3

Отправлено 25 Ноябрь 2014 - 07:00

Если быть совсем точным это делается Ajax-ом методом 

loadurl("здесь ссылка", "#content - id куда загружается данные")

. Но для обычных сайтов такая реализация не очень хорошая идея. Потому что не будет внутренних целевых страниц все страницы будут загружаться через индексный файл. И соответственно поисковые роботы поиндесируют только главную страницу. 


  • 0

#4 kamchatniyoleg

kamchatniyoleg
  • Пользователь PRO
  • 1 178 сообщений
  • Репутация: 84

Отправлено 25 Ноябрь 2014 - 09:31

temp-market, Заметил я тут давеча, что проиндексировал робот контент который только аяксом и грузился! Удивлению предела не было =) 

 

А по вопросу ТС - ajax вам в помощь. Если это какой нибудь блок с новинками особенно!


  • 0
Сервис электронного информирования клиентов PostTrail.ru
Отслеживание посылок Почты России в автоматическом режиме! Лояльность клиента - прибыль магазина!


#5 Sosnovskij

Sosnovskij
  • Администратор
  • 3 946 сообщений
  • Репутация: 579

Отправлено 25 Ноябрь 2014 - 09:52

Только здесь это вроду бы реализовано обычно.

@hnerd, Да. Там табы без ajax. 


  • 0

Не стесняйтесь ставить оценки темам :) Правила форума. Мой блог http://sosnovskij.ru/.




Оформление форума – IPBSkins.ru